9-Amino-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roacridine bis 1,7-heptylene dihydrochloride (CAS 224445-12-9), with the empirical formula C33H40N4 · 2HCl and a molecular weight of 565.62, is a chemical compound supplied by Tech Serve Solutions. This substance is recognised for its role as an enzyme inhibitor, particularly within biochemical research and the study of enzyme mechanisms. Its specific properties make it a valuable tool for scientific investigation.

02 /Properties
Molecular weight565.62
Empirical formulaC33H40N4 · 2HCl
Assay>97%
SolubilityH2O: >10 mg/mL
Storage temperature2-8°C

What are the safety and handling precautions for this chemical?

+

This compound is classified as 'T' (Toxic) in Europe, with European hazard statements including R25 (Toxic if swallowed) and R36/37/38 (Irritating to eyes, respiratory system, and skin). Recommended safety statements include S26 (In case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ice), S36 (Wear suitable protective clothing), and S45 (In case of accident or if you feel unwell, seek medical advice immediately). Handle with appropriate personal protective equipment in a well-ventilated area. Dispose of in accordance with local regulations.
